Palisade, Colorado Wineries
Palisade, Colorado is a unique wine destination nestled along the Colorado River in the western part of the state. Known for its warmer, arid climate and unique high-altitude terroir, this region offers a distinctive setting for wine production. With approximately 14 active wineries, Palisade has cultivated a reputation for producing diverse grape varieties like Cabernet Franc, Merlot, and Chardonnay. The region’s volcanic soils and dramatic diurnal temperature shifts contribute to the creation of wines with vibrant acidity and rich flavors, drawing wine enthusiasts eager to explore its boutique wineries.
The wine tourism experience in Palisade is enhanced by the region's picturesque landscapes, featuring panoramic views of the Book Cliffs and Grand Mesa. Visitors can enjoy personalized tasting experiences at award-winning wineries such as Colterris Wines, Avant Vineyards, and Carlson Vineyards. These venues often provide opportunities for direct interaction with winemakers and the chance to explore local tasting rooms, offering a warm and inviting atmosphere. Palisade's location along Colorado's Western Slope makes it a convenient stop for travelers exploring the wider Rocky Mountain wine trails.
